Mothers: Be Good To Yourself


Mothers: take care of yourself on Mother’s Day. Get a yearly mammogram starting at 40 years of age and a Pap smear every one to three years. Breast and cervical cancer are diseases that can be identified and treated in their early stages.

The Genesee County Health Department offers a FREE mammogram, Pap smear, breast exam and pelvic exam for those who qualify. To qualify, a woman must be 40 years or older and of moderate income, with or without insurance. Exams take place at three different locations and are conducted by female healthcare providers.
